  1. Phishing Attacks: These involve tricking users into revealing their login credentials through fake emails or websites that mimic legitimate services like Facebook.
  2. Data Breaches: When a database containing user credentials is compromised, the information can be stolen and potentially shared or sold on the dark web.
  3. Malware: Certain types of malware are designed to capture and store user credentials, which can then be transmitted to malicious actors.
